Well it’s just about to air here in the UK, but last night the US found out a little about Terminus in the Walking Dead TV show and what it’s all about… but there’s much still to learn.

Executive Producer Scott Gimple has been chatting with Collider about what Terminus is and what the next season will mean for those who (arrived) survived: “With the group separated, the back half of the fourth season has essentially been a batch of contemplative character studies. With many of them now reunited, expect that tone to change for the fifth season. Gimple tells Deadline that the season is planned out and they are planned out and they are already well into the writing stage.

“I would say that these next eight episodes are going to be a little more action-heavy, with a lot of big twists. Really 85% of them are together again, so it’s a pretty good guess that they’re going to remain together and that’s going to give us a whole new emotional dynamic as well. So I guess the biggest thing is prepare for a very different Walking Dead. Yet again.”

Rick utters a line right at the end of the episode that, when combined with the human bodies piled up, strongly suggests that the Terminus people are, as has been rumoured for a few weeks, cannibals – Walking Dead comic and game fans may see similarities with the Hunters story and the cannibal thread in the Telltale Games game: “In reading the comic no one’s going to get exactly what happens, but they will be able to see points of inspiration from it [but the episode] does not definitively tell you whether or not they’re cannibals” but we will find out early on in season five.”

Robert Kirkman, chatting to The Live Feed, said: “We’re going to be dealing with Terminus in a big way as soon as we come back. We’re also going to be dealing with a more capable and prepared Rick Grimes coming out of what he’s experienced in this episode. He’s going to go into another really awesome direction. 

“There is a very deep, dark and storied history to Terminus and how these people came to be that will be revealed in season five. There are an enormous amount of hints here and there in the finale that you could freeze frame and study and dig into over the span of months between the end of season four and the beginning of season five that will in some cases give you some pretty good hints and other cases be deliberately misleading as we intend it.”
